07-17-2005, 11:12 PM
[QUOTE=dancetomdance182]He uses Mesa Boogie Triple Rectifiers, and for cleans Marshall JCM 900. He used to blend them together.[/QUOTE
how can u have two heads adn use em both? so he uses a rectifier fro distorion but for the clean tracks he uses a marshall jcm 900. does he use one head and two diff cabs? if so which head? but if he does have two seperate heads how is it possible to use both some kind of foot switch?
He uses a A/B footswitch. I forgot which brand it was, but it allows 2 amps to be used at the same time, or 1 at a time. In a guitarcenter interview, Tom said that he loves the dist. of Mesas, but not the cleans, but loved the cleans of Marshalls, but didn't like the dist. So he mixed them together. Also, he has 3 cabs.
